Fire Protection Engineering Enrollment Policy
Fire Protection Engineering program students may register for other UMD course(s)/ section(s), beginning on the first day of class, subject to seat availability. Program-admitted students who register for course(s) / section(s) outside of the Fire Protection Engineering program are charged tuition at the per-credit rate for those courses based on their residency.
Maintain Continuous Enrollment
Students who do not plan to register for courses in a fall or spring semester must submit a Petition for Waiver of Continuous Registration for each semester of non-attendance. If you fail to register or submit the waiver, you must reapply and pay the application fee.
The deadline to submit the petition is the last day of schedule adjustment for the semester of non-attendance. See Academic and Financial Deadlines.
